Boston, November 28.   We hear that in pursuance of a
deputation lately received from his grace the Duke of
Beaufort, Grand Master of Masons, Wednesday was solemnized
at the Grand Lodge of Free and Accepted Masons in this town,
at their meeting at concert-hall, the installation of the
right worshipful John Rowe, Esq; Grand master, in the room
of Jeremy Gridley, Esq. deceased.--After the installation of
the fraternity in their order, with their proper significant
jewels and badges, went in procession from concert-hall
attended by a very large band of music, to Trinity's church,
where a sermon was preached the brotherhood by the Rev. Mr.
Bass of Newbury:  After service they returned in procession,
the order of which was varied, to concert-hall, where was a
most elegant entertainment provided, after dinner they had a
variety of music, and many excellent songs were sung.
